The Heard's sanctuary is different every day of the year. As you walk the nature trails you encounter numerous sights, sounds, colors, textures and patterns. You may also encounter many species of birds, insects and animals that have found refuge in the sanctuary, an oasis within the rapidly developing Collin County area.

Heard nature trails are not currently wheelchair accessible. The trails are only accessible to running strollers. The Heard is currently working on plans to make some of our trails accessible to our guests in wheelchairs and regular strollers. Our indoor exhibits, however, are wheelchair and stroller accessible.
